Tasks Your Virtual Medical Admin Assistant Can Handle
| Category | Specific Tasks | Time Saved Per Week |
|---|---|---|
| Patient Scheduling | Appointment booking, rescheduling, reminders | 8 hours |
| Insurance Work | Verification, prior authorizations, claims follow-up | 6 hours |
| Medical Records | EHR updates, file organization, record requests | 5 hours |
| Phone Management | Patient calls, prescription refills, lab results | 4 hours |
| Billing Support | Invoice creation, payment processing, collections | 3 hours |
Your virtual assistant handles these daily tasks while you focus on patient care.
This frees up 26 hours per week for more appointments and better patient service.
Patients get faster responses and better service from dedicated admin support.
Virtual medical assistants can access most EHR systems remotely with proper HIPAA training and secure connections.

A Day In The Life Of Your Medical Admin VA
Your virtual assistant starts early, checking overnight patient messages and appointment requests.
Morning hours focus on insurance verifications for the day’s scheduled patients.
Afternoon time handles phone calls, prescription refills, and lab result communications.
End-of-day tasks include updating patient records and preparing tomorrow’s schedule.
Set up dedicated phone hours for your VA to handle patient calls, freeing your clinic staff for in-person patient care.
What Makes A Great Virtual Medical Administrator
The best medical virtual assistants understand healthcare workflows and patient needs.
They have experience with medical software like Epic, Cerner, or Practice Fusion.
HIPAA compliance training ensures patient information stays secure and private.
Strong communication skills help them handle sensitive patient conversations with care.

Common Mistakes To Avoid
Some doctors try to save money by hiring cheap overseas assistants without medical training.
Others fail to provide proper EHR access, making their assistant less effective.
Not setting clear patient communication rules can lead to confusion and errors.
Skipping HIPAA compliance training puts your practice at legal risk.
